HDR photograph of the stained glass window at St. Margaret's Church Herringfleet, Suffolk by Timothy Selvage.

 

I was lucky to discover this church and only stopped by on recomendation after visiting Haddiscoe Priory (pictures soon to follow).

 

After seeing the beautiful windows I found this website www.suffolkchurches.co.uk/herringfleet.htm which provides useful information about this church and the windows...

 

'Some of the glass is interesting because it is so unusual, but more unusual than any of the medieval and continental work is the scattering of panes by the Lowestoft artist Robert Allen. Allen owned a glass factory, and produced 'picture glass' at a time when almost nobody else in England was doing it, the end of the 18th and the start of the 19th century. Because of this, he work is entirely pre-ecclesiological - that is to say, it comes from a time before the Oxford Movement had led the 19th century Anglican revival which led to the restoration of churches and the installation of thousands of stained glass windows across the country, mostly of biblical and devotional subjects. The other major figure in this restoration was Samuel Yarrington, the Norwich glazier, who probably arranged and set it all, and may well have been the agent who sold the glass to Leathes in the first place'.

Rolls Royce 40:50 Silver Ghost (1906-25) Engine 7036cc S6 SV

Production 6173

Chassis Number 101EM

Engine Number S-100

Registration Number XT 209 (London)

ROLLS ROYCE SET

 

www.flickr.com/photos/45676495@N05/sets/72157623690651737...

 

This extraordinary Silver Ghost, started life in 1924, originally bodied by coachbuilders Windovers Ltd., in March 1924 as an 'enclosed drive limousine'. it was first owned by Bracewell Smith Esq. (later Sir Bracewell Smith MP), Conservative MP for Dulwich 1932-45 and Lord Mayor of London 1946. Whos address was quoted as The Shaftsbury Hotel WC2, and later Park Lane Hotel WC1 which was part of his property empire

 

Nothing is known of its ownership from then until 1959, but at some stage it was converted to a shooting brake with a platform on the roof, another folding down at the rear, with fittings for a third at the front, all for the mounting of ciné cameras. It is understood that the conversion was carried out for a film company, and may have been one of two such camera cars, used for outside broadcasts and horse racing, one is seen on film, filming the London to Brighton run in Genevieve. This one also appeared in the Alec Guiness film - The Man in the White Suit.

 

In 1959, George du Boulay bought the by then somewhat dilapidated Silver Ghost from Carr Brothers in Purley for the sum of £99. Naming the car Gawain from the Knight in Arthurian legend. George Boulay had six children so holidays had become logistically difficult. The Rolls Royce was seen as a solution to the problem and the Shooting Brake was converted into a 'caravanette': slightly raising the roof, installing storage lockers and a water tank on the roof platform, and replacing the seats with a long fold-down bench at the rear, with more storage lockers, a cooker and wash basin opposite. There was a double back to back seat of the owners design that folded flat for sleeping and at a pinch all members of the family could sleep inside over night. It was used extensively by the family throughout the early sixties with a kitchen tent attached to the rear making a sheltered corridor through which the family could scramble through to sit or dine on the folded rear platform. it was retained by the Boulay family until 2007when it was decided to donate Gawain to the Sir Henry Royce Memorial Foundation. in 2008 it was the subject of a £ 15,000 restoration by marque specialist Overton Vehicle Overhauls of Leigh-on-Sea, Essex. In 2015 it was sold at auction by Bonhams, on behalf of the Sir Henry Royce Memorial Foundation with an auction recomendation price of £ 70,000 to £ 90,000

 

Progressively modernised over its long production life the Silver Ghost (as the model became known after its 1907 demonstrator), gained electric lighting and starting in 1919, a starting carburretor and twin ignition in 1921, and four wheel brakes in 1924. With virtually everything made by Rolls Royce. The car offered silence, refinement and comfort, and in 1911 one was timed at 101.8mph at Brooklands, with a streamlined single seat body

Military medal won by my Great Uncle, Bill Hewit at Cambrai in France during WW1. He was a driver in the Royal Field Artillery, a driver then being in charge of a team of horses rather than a vehicle. It is a level 3 galantry award, a VC being ranked level 1. The notes sent with his recomendation for the medal read,

On the night of Sept 26th/18 at Cambrai being the leading Driver in the team, showing great skill and courage when under very heavy shell fire, and got through safely.
